4th Question: Are there any other examples or references within the book of Revelation that you see could be interpreted as technology or artificial intelligence?

AI replied: “

The Book of Revelation is a highly symbolic and metaphorical work, and as such, it has been subject to many different interpretations throughout history. Some people have suggested that certain passages or images in the book could be interpreted as references to technology or artificial intelligence, but these interpretations are not widely accepted and are often highly speculative.
That being said, there are some passages in the book that some people have interpreted as having technological or futuristic overtones. For example, in Revelation 13:15, it describes a beast that has the ability to give life to an image, causing it to speak and command the worship of people. Some have interpreted this as a reference to advanced technology, such as artificial intelligence or holographic projections.
Similarly, in Revelation 9:7-10, it describes an army of locusts with the faces of men, teeth like lions, and wings that sound like the noise of chariots. Some have suggested that this description could be interpreted as a reference to modern military technology, such as drones or fighter jets.
However, it is important to note that these interpretations are speculative and not widely accepted. The Book of Revelation is a highly symbolic work, and its meaning is open to interpretation. Ultimately, the interpretation of the book is a matter of faith and belief, and different people may see different things in its pages.”
